摘要:
按照网上的方法,各种调试不成功,后来改成用共享MFC的dll,然后回退新加的代码,再把#include #ifndef _AFX_NO_DB_SUPPORT#include // MFC ODBC #endif // _AFX_NO_DB_SUPPORT#ifndef _AFX_NO_DAO_SUP... 阅读全文
摘要:
osg编译例子的时候,打开文件就出问题,可能是一些不兼容的问题qt编译的是时候要添加qt和vs2010的整合工具,这样才能把 vs2010里面的QTDIR变量和环境变量QTDIR关联起来同是右击文件属性,可以选则处理源文件的工具,默认是c/c++编译器,也可以使用命令行定义其它的开发工具调试osg的... 阅读全文
摘要:
笔记本一般有双显卡,默认可以切换,但是使用浏览器打开的要合适的浏览器打开WEBGL程序,包括驱动,浏览器,有时候需要手工设置独立显卡一般来说价钱四五千以上的笔记本电脑都是支持WEBGL的,而且可以自动切换如果不现实WEBGL程序的话,可以下载个最新的chrome版本,因为有的浏览器可能安装的时候有问... 阅读全文
摘要:
C:\Program Files (x86)\MSBuild\Microsoft.Cpp\v4.0\V120\Microsoft.CppCommon.targets!提示找不到CMAKELIST.TXT,同时CMD.EXE退出主要原因是工程文件里面包含有CMAKELIST.TEXT文件,这个时候要么... 阅读全文
摘要:
假设源代码入在D:\3DFrame\qt-everywhere-opensource-src-5.4.0\qt-everywhere-opensource-src-5.4.01:首先从官方网站下载源代码2:因为是直接从官方网站下载的源代码,D:\3DFrame\qt-everywhere-opens... 阅读全文
摘要:
webgl,three.js交流的论坛,欢迎到里面提问问题www.webglchina.cn 阅读全文
摘要:
齐次坐标是什么意思,怎么理解,网上有很多文章,有的说的貌似很清楚,其实并没有说到点子上。齐次坐标本身是什么并不重要,它仅仅是[x,y,z,w],是一个有序的数对,它是什么取决于用它做什么,就像[x,y,z]即可以做一个向量,也可以做为一个点一样,关于在于你怎么用它。本人认为它就是一种数学的技巧,它的... 阅读全文
摘要:
osg使用过一年,阅读过一部分源代码,vtk也断续使用过三四年了,ogre研究的比较深入,基本上比较熟悉它的整体结构,说说个人的看法vtk是一个算法库,里面包括了很多挺不错的算法,如果做有限元云图,等值线,特别是医疗方面的算法,有很大的参加价值,我曾经把它的等值线算法提取出来一个类就可以实现,主要函... 阅读全文
摘要:
(一) 有效的性能评测 对于任何一个3D应用程序来说,追求场景画面真实感是一个无止尽的目标,其结果就是让我们的场景越来越复杂,模型更加精细,这必然给图形硬件带来极大的负荷以致于无法达到实时绘制帧率。因此,渲染优化是必不可少的。在渲染优化之前,我们需要对应用程序性能进行系统的评测,找出瓶颈,对症下药。对于3D应用程序来说,影响性能的十分多,同时不同的硬件配置条件下,瓶径也会有所不同。因此,对应用程序进行有效的性能评测,不仅需要对整个渲染管线原理有深入地了解,此外借助一些评测工具能让我们的工作事倍功半。我们知道渲染流水线的速度是由最慢的阶段决定首先... 阅读全文
摘要:
什么是OpenGL中的深度、深度缓存、深度测试?2011-05-01 10:50:32|分类: 默认分类 |标签:opengl |字号大中小订阅 1)直观理解深度其实就是该象素点在3d世界中距离摄象机的距离,深度缓存中存储着每个象素点(绘制在屏幕上的)的深度值!深度测试决定了是否绘制较远的象素点(或较近的象素点),通常选用较近的,而较远优先能实现透视的效果!!!2)Z值(深度值)、Z buffer(深度缓存) 下面先讲讲Z坐标。Z坐标和X、Y坐标一样。在变换、裁减和透视除法后,Z的范围为-1.0~1.0。DepthRange映射指定Z坐标的变换,这与用于将X和Y映射到窗口坐标的视口变换类似,但 阅读全文